WATCH: 19-year-old Avalanche Rookie Calum Ritchie Scores First Career NHL Goal in Style

Calum Ritchie opened the scoring for the Avalanche on Monday, scoring his first career NHL goal in his third game.



The 19-year-old, who is skating on the second line with Casey Mittelstadt and Miles Wood, received a nice feed from Josh Manson along the boards and tapped it in back door past New York Islanders goalie Ilya Sorokin at 1:01 of the first period.
